Important IS Codes for Civil Engineering

The following table gives a quick reference of commonly used IS codes in civil engineering. This table is for learning and reference purpose, and final details should be verified from official publications.

IS CodeTopicCommon Use
IS 456Plain and reinforced concrete designRCC beams, slabs, columns, footings and concrete structures
IS 800General construction in steelSteel structure design and steel member checking
IS 875Design loads for buildings and structuresDead load, live load, wind load and other building loads
IS 1893Earthquake resistant design criteriaSeismic design and earthquake load calculation
IS 13920Ductile detailing of reinforced concrete structuresEarthquake resistant RCC detailing
IS 10262Concrete mix design guidelinesConcrete mix proportioning and mix design
IS 383Coarse and fine aggregate specificationAggregate quality and grading for concrete
IS 1786High strength deformed steel barsTMT bars and reinforcement steel
IS 516Concrete strength testingConcrete cube testing and strength testing reference
IS 1199Fresh concrete testingWorkability and fresh concrete tests
IS 3370Concrete structures for retaining aqueous liquidsWater tanks and liquid retaining structures
IS 1343Prestressed concretePrestressed concrete design reference

IS 456 for RCC Design

IS 456 is one of the most important IS codes for civil engineers. It is commonly used for plain and reinforced concrete design. RCC beams, columns, slabs, footings and many concrete structures are designed with reference to this code.

IS 800 for Steel Structure Design

IS 800 is commonly used for general construction in steel. It is useful for steel beams, columns, connections, compression members, tension members and steel structure design checks.

Steel design requires checking strength, stability, slenderness, buckling, connections and serviceability. IS 800 is an important reference for structural steel design in India.

IS 875 for Building Loads

IS 875 is used for design loads on buildings and structures. Load calculation is required before structural design because beams, columns, slabs and foundations must safely carry dead load, live load, wind load and other applicable loads.

Civil engineers use load calculation for RCC design, steel design, foundation design and structural analysis. Correct load assessment is one of the first steps in safe structural design.

IS 1893 and IS 13920 for Earthquake Resistant Design

IS 1893 is commonly used for earthquake resistant design criteria, while IS 13920 is used for ductile detailing of reinforced concrete structures. These codes are important for seismic design and detailing in earthquake-prone regions.

Earthquake resistant design is not only about member size. Proper detailing, ductility, reinforcement anchorage and load path are also important for structural safety.

IS 10262 for Concrete Mix Design

IS 10262 is commonly used for concrete mix proportioning. Concrete mix design helps engineers decide cement, water, fine aggregate, coarse aggregate and admixture proportions for a required concrete grade and workability.
